    Hey, everyone! Inspired by people far more talented than me, I decided to start making my own Transformers designs. So far, I've only made two. Maybe there'll be more someday, I don't know. First off, we have (of course), my favorite character, Bumblebee!

    My Transformers Design.png

    I took a lot of inspiration from the Movie-verse Bumblebee design. I'm probably just stealing it, simplifying it, and adding black. I love muscle car Bumblebee, so that was the obvious inspiration for it. The design is based more specifically on the Movie Deluxe Concept Camaro Bumblebee, with a a head design directly based on the one Bumblebee had in IDW's "Death of Optimus Prime" one-shot. In car mode, for one, you can clearly see that I suck at drawing cars. You might also notice that the booster-ed car mode is kind of based on Animated Bumblebee's rocket boosters. All in all, it's not very original, but I thought I might share it with you.

    Grimlock is slightly more original. You'll definitely notice that the robot mode is based largely on the AOE design, but simplified, and with a more G1/IDW-like head. I decided to go for an organic look for Grimlock because honestly, I thought it might be an interesting change from from the usual (though still awesome) mechanical T-Rex. If you've seen the documentary, Walking With Dinosaurs, you'll be able to tell that the beast mode is a homage to the Tyrannosaurus from that series. I grew up watching that
    program, and the colors seemed to fit Grimlock well enough that I just had to base him off of that design.

    Heeeeeere's Starscream!

    My Transformers Design.png

    I decided to go for a slightly beefier Prime-inspired design, with some inspirations from the G1 and Movie Starscreams. He actually towers over Grimlock scale-wise, but then again, I am trying for real life proportions. You may notice some scarring on his face, and a noticeable red X over his Decepticon symbols. That's because I see this Starscream as having been booted from the Decepticons by Megatron and presumed dead, until he resurfaced leading his own faction, which I can't think of a name for. Maybe "Starscream's Brigade", or something. The hunched over posture I tried to incorporate is meant to be the result of a particularly vicious beating from Megatron.
